Air Potato Leaf Beetle

Lilioceris cheni

Field Notes

Description:

There were tons of these on the air potatoes, and you can see how much they skeletonized the leaves in the last photo.

Habitat:

On air potato plants near a river in a shady oak forest - Hogtown Creek at Alfred Ring Park

Notes:

These were introduced to Florida in 2012 to eat the invasive air potatoes. They are not known to eat any other plants and cannot complete their life cycle without air potatoes.
